The American Goldfinch is a commonly seen yellow bird in Oregon. It is known for its vibrant yellow plumage, which is particularly bright and striking during the breeding season. The male American Goldfinch has a black cap and wings with a white wing bar.

American Goldfinch (Spinus Tristis) Size: 11 - 13cm Weight: 11 - 20 grams Wingspan: 19 - 22cm American goldfinches are non-breeding residents in western Oregon and in the rest of the state they can be found year round. These finches are recognised by their yellow, white and black plumage.

Yellow warbler Bringing its cheerful song to streamside thickets throughout the state each breeding season, the bright and active Yellow warbler seems to be the incarnation of summer. Notable for its vivid color, it has been described as a "rich yellow flame among the opening leaves."

Common Birds in Oregon 1. Song Sparrow The Song Sparrow (Melospiza melodia) is a medium-sized sparrow commonly found in North America. Song Sparrows have a streaked brown upper body and a white or gray underbody with dark streaks. They have a rounded head, a long tail, and a robust, conical bill.

What is the Oregon state bird? The state bird of Oregon is the western meadowlark. It has a flute-like song, which makes it easy to recognize the bird before it is seen. The yellow-breasted chat is a species of bird that can be found in Oregon. Male chats are known for thir loud and continuous singing, which can sometimes be heard throughout the night. 1. American Robin American Robins are very common and can be spotted all year in Oregon. They are recorded in 46% of summer checklists and 35% of winter checklists submitted by bird watchers for the state. American Robins are a common sight on lawns eating earthworms. They have black heads and backs with red or orange breasts.

The city of Bend in Central Oregon is influenced by birds of eastern Oregon and the high Cascades. Thus, birds in this town are much different than the birds of western Oregon towns.
